Durability and Low Maintenance

One of the main benefits of using prepainted steel fencing is that it is extremely durable and requires very little maintenance. Steel fences won't rot or decay as wooden fences can and don't attract pests like termites or ants. This means that you won't have to worry about frequent repairs or costly replacements down the line. Additionally, this fencing won't need to be painted or stained every few years like other types of fencing. Instead, the paint will hold up well over time with minimal upkeep required from you.

Appearance and Versatility

Another great benefit of prepainted steel fencing is its attractive appearance and versatility. You can choose various colours to match your existing decor and styles to suit any aesthetic preference. This type of fence also looks great on both sides, so no matter where you stand, your property will always look neat and tidy. Finally, because steel fences are so versatile, you can customise them in whatever way works best for your particular needs, whether that means adding gates or extra panels for security purposes or simply creating a more aesthetically pleasing design around your property.

Cost Savings 

Finally, prepainted steel fencing can be cost-effective compared to other types of fencing materials, such as wood or aluminium. They typically require fewer labour hours during installation due to their prefabricated nature, which translates into big savings on setup costs.
